OneMagnify celebrated for third consecutive year as One of India's Best Places to Work in 2024

CHENNAI, INDIA - Media OutReach Newswire - 24 June 2024 - Onemagnify, a multidisciplinary marketing and communications company, has been recently awarded the best place to work certification for 2024. This prestigious recognition is based on the assessment results, where an impressive 92% of employees rated the company as a great place to work compared to a market average of 76%.

This honor marks the third consecutive year that OneMagnify has been recognized for its outstanding workplace culture and employee engagement.

Best Places to Work is an international certification program, considered as the 'Platinum Standard' in identifying and recognizing top workplaces around the world, provides employers the opportunity to learn more about the engagement and the satisfaction of their employees and honour those who deliver an outstanding work experience with the highest standards in regards to people management practices.
